A Program for Harvard College, 1957, by Ritter and Lerner. Digital
Scope and Contents
Profile of Harvard University including campus exteriors and faculty. McGeorge Bundy is featured and narrates majority of film. Brief mention of Radcliffe students around 25 minutes.

The preeminent research library on the history of women in the United States, the Schlesinger Library documents women's lives from the past and present for the future. In addition to its traditional strengths in the history of feminisms, women’s health, and women’s activism, the Schlesinger collections document the intersectional workings of race and ethnicity, gender, sexuality, and class in American history.
